Christmas Week Weather - 22-27 December 2014 After Winter Solstice at 2303 GMT Sunday were now heading towards Spring! On our journey we leave the 4th Sunday of Advent and head into Christmas week on a cloudy note. Monday will be windy with a few splashes of rain; although most of us should be dry and mild with highs of around an unseasonable 11 or 12. Ditto for Tuesday with highs of 13. Rain for awhile into Christmas Eve will clear and behind the cold weather front responsible, Wednesday will be clear, sunny and dry if cold. Highs of 9 celsius, 48 farenheit. Itll be a cool and frosty night for the carols and midnight mass, followed by a dry and bright Christmas Day. Itll be breezy again and cool - 8 feeling pretty nippy for the post Christmas lunch ramble. Thursday night will be cold and frosty again with thermometers below zero for many of us. Boxing Day stays settled thanks to a ridge of high pressure. It stays dry but cold with a sunny spells, variable cloud and highs of only 7. Make the most of the calm conditions as theres every indication that things turn wet and windy as we head into next weekend.
